In our organization we use hp laptops and desktops with windows 10 that have the Azure virtual desktop client for Windows.
We also have 5 HP T630 thin clients which are supported for use with Azure virtual desktop.
On the laptops en desktops with the azure virtual desktop client installed on, they get when connected to a win10 virtual desktop initially the right keyboard layout and language, NLD-AZERTY in our case.
When we use the Azure virtual desktop client on a t630 thin client, and get connected to a win10 virtual desktop the keyboard layout and language is initially ENG-QWERTY and we have to manually select the correct one on the taskbar and choose NLD - AZERTY. This extra step is to difficult for our users and we would like to have it set to initially NLD-AZERTY like it is on the normal laptops and desktops we have.
The settings on the thin client itself are correct and NLD-AZERTY.
Does anybody have a solution for using AVD on thin client and having the correct keyboard layout and language from te beginning?
